I'll tell you something else, some time ago my father used one of his
Imps and reversed it off our drive to park it in front of the house.
Then I saw that the Imp jumped foreward and came to a halt on the street.
To my surprise then my dad openend the side window, stuck out his
arm holding a guess what... broken off gearstick !!
Ha Ha what laugh, you should have seen my dads face !
Anyway we used a mole grip on the stump to shift the gears.
Apparantly this happens more often with an Imp as there is a sharp
edge on the bottom of it and due to metal fatigue it will allways shear off
on that edge.
Well ok end of life will take about 25 years which isn't bad at all.
So when it is not the gearknob it's the gearstick !
